Output 3666ee52c8f79ad2918124d26801b6d3c53e13c880fdb3d480ebe67744310a79:1

value
1521535
script pubkey
OP_0 OP_PUSHBYTES_20 0e8ddcdf9054c4c69a39827352335c9d2ee3573d
address
bc1qp6xaehus2nzvdx3esfe4yv6un5hwx4ea922cth
transaction
3666ee52c8f79ad2918124d26801b6d3c53e13c880fdb3d480ebe67744310a79
spent
true